I have a CTX touchscreen that I found on e-bay that I plan to run ACE Client
on eventually. The screen has a VGA connection and a serial-type connection
to an ISA driver card. I don't know much about other touchscreens, I assuem
they have a similar type setup. I bought the one I have used for only $100.
